“…Although the initial findings demonstrating antidepressant-relevant biological activity of ( 2R,6R )-HNK have been widely replicated and expanded upon by a number of independent research groups (Bonaventura et al, 2022; Cavalleri et al, 2018; Chen et al, 2018; Chou et al, 2018; Collo et al, 2018; Fred et al, 2019; Fukumoto et al, 2019; Pham et al, 2018; Wray et al, 2018; Yao et al, 2018; Ye et al, 2019), (2 R, 6 R )-HNK is one of the major brain metabolites of ( R,S )-ketamine, but its antidepressant-like activity and contribution to the actions of the parent drug has been contested (Abdallah, 2017; Collingridge et al, 2017; Zanos et al, 2017). We previously showed that a systemic or intra-cortical administration of ( 6 )-HNK displayed similar sustained antidepressant-like behavioral actions to those of ( R,S )-ketamine (i.e., at 24 hours post-injection (t24h)) when assessed using the forced swim test (FST).…”
